## Changelog — Font vendoring defaults changed

As of this release, the Bracken UI build no longer fetches third-party fonts at build time. All typefaces used by the Lanternwell suite are now vendored into the repo under a dedicated assets directory, and the fetch step is skipped by default. If you're onboarding, nothing to install — the fonts travel with the checkout. The build flags controlling this behavior are listed below.

settings of hadup-yafog:
LAMAEL_PIN=3761
LAMAEL_TENANT=istmir
LAMAEL_METRICS_HOST=metrics.lamael.plorvasys.test
LAMAEL_SEAL=seal_8ea68500
LAMAEL_STANDBY_TEAM=fraok

v1.9.4 — key rotation

Context: the websocket reconnect bug (Pondwire client looping on stale auth) was traced to handshake tokens signed with the deprecated key. Rotated it. Reconnect storm stops because new tokens validate cleanly on first attempt.

Changes: removed old key from the broker config, added jitter to reconnect backoff, tightened token TTL to 15m. No schema changes. Old tokens expire naturally within the hour. For verification, the replacement signing key follows:

signing key of kafop-yajeg = bky3_7UA

Test Plan Note — Calendar Sync Conflict (Tindervale Scheduler)

Scenario: two clients edit the same event offline, then sync. Expected behavior: the Larkmoor merge service keeps the later timestamp and files a conflict record. Verify the losing edit appears in the conflicts pane and no duplicate events are created. Run against the staging tenant only. Authenticate your test client to the sync endpoint using the bearer token below.

bearer token for hagug-kawip: eyJhbGciOiJIUzI1NiIsInR5cCI6IkpXVCJ9.eyJzdWIiOiIydxNAjDeTmIn0.L86yxoGFcrhy

## Runbook: Payroll Export Cutover

Welcome aboard! When shipping the new comma-delimited payroll export for Fernbrook HR, run the format validator first, then bump the schema version in the manifest. Don't skip the dry-run against staging data. Once the bundle passes validation, sign it with the release key below:

rollout seal: bky4_x7Gc